VinFast to deliver first EVs March 1, slashes VF 8 lease price

Vietnamese electric vehicle maker VinFast  will start delivery of VF 8 City Edition vehicles to US customers beginning March 1, 2023. The delivery event will be held at the VinFast’s store in California, marking VinFast’s new journey in the international market.

These initial deliveries are from the first shipment of 999 City Edition vehicles, which were shipped to the US in December 2022. The VF 8 City Edition comes in both Eco and Plus trim with an EPA-rated range of 207 miles and 191 miles respectively.

VinFast has also reduced the lease price for its initial model shipped to the United States by over 50% for its first customers in California.

Initially, VinFast announced that a 24-month lease for its fully electric VF 8 crossover would be priced at $599 per month at the start of 2023. However, the company’s website now displays a 24-month lease costing $399 per month.

Additionally, according to Reuters, VinFast has informed individuals who have already made a refundable deposit on the vehicle that the payment in California, the first state in the United States to receive the cars, will be $274 per month.

The VF 8 City Edition customer delivery event will be held on March 1st at the VinFast store in California and, for those customers unable to attend the event, beginning on March 2nd, customers can have their vehicles delivered at home or they may schedule a pickup at a VinFast store. VinFast also announced multiple test drive events throughout California for customers to best experience VinFast’s EVs.

The VF 8 City Edition offers many smart technology features such as Advanced Driver Assistance System (ADAS) and Smart Services to become a mobile platform that connects all aspects of life. These features will be enhanced regularly using over-the-air (FOTA) updates to improve vehicle functionality and customer experience.

Several leading insurance companies in the US have confirmed that they will provide vehicle insurance for VinFast owners. VinFast also offers a 10-year warranty for their vehicles and batteries, as well as mobile repair services, and 24/7 roadside assistance.

Madam Le Thi Thu Thuy, Vice Chair of Vingroup and Chairwoman of VinFast Holdings shared: “Our team worked tirelessly to ensure VinFast vehicles meet the highest standards of quality, fit and finish our customers expect. The presence of VinFast electric cars on US streets in the coming days is an important milestone, accelerating VinFast’s journey to compete in the US and abroad. Following deliveries in the US market, VinFast expects to deliver EVs in Canada, France, Germany, and the Netherlands.”
